Output 096625b498404fe3a24473cdfb279dccfa2f28555a6215c68b277101afc907cf:2

value
12212881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 652ca71a870ea75097f7acf6bcf4fe75065bc6fd OP_EQUAL
address
3AuyfSpYfbfGi5rXyHwMkoXPfcJw5A1amq
transaction
096625b498404fe3a24473cdfb279dccfa2f28555a6215c68b277101afc907cf
spent
true